Output 681ec0042a06059ed51a7b3f077796a69e9fe67d9ded5a6bc17f15fdfdd73119:290

value
420545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ed010827753e1f8a626696686c4ed8c6c99e5f3 OP_EQUAL
address
3K5wZZmaThGtRkRFz28k9NjgMrvW4dxHwF
transaction
681ec0042a06059ed51a7b3f077796a69e9fe67d9ded5a6bc17f15fdfdd73119
spent
true